Mötley Crüe continue to celebrate the 30th anniversary of their fourth studio, and 4x platinum album, Girls, Girls, Girls, with a new, official lyric video for the album opener, “Wild Side”. Watch the video below. Special album reissue bundles of Girls, Girls, Girls are available here.

Mötley Crüe paved the way for rock bands to push the envelope since the band’s inception and their music, as well as their antics, provided them a successful 36-year career as a leading force in rock around the world. 1987’s Girls, Girls, Girls included three smash hits, “Wild Side”, “You’re All I Need”, and the title track, which became a global success, despite the original uncensored video being banned from MTV at the time; check it out below. The album itself, explores themes inspired by the band’s hard-living lifestyle of booze, drugs, strip clubs, love of motorcycles, and death.

Mötley Crüe bassist Nikki Sixx says: “It’s hard to believe Girls, Girls, Girls already turned 30 this year. We went against the grain with this album when it first came out in 1987. The music and lyrics reflect what was going on in the streets of Los Angeles at that time. A big thank you to all the fans who have made the album stand the test of time. It’s really cool to now see a new generation of fans exploring and digging Girls, Girls, Girls three decades later.”
